What a Qualified Ayurvedic Doctor in Dubai Actually Does

A BAMS-qualified Ayurvedic doctor, a Bachelor of Ayurvedic Medicine and Surgery, completes five and a half years of undergraduate medical training, followed by a one-year clinical internship. That education covers Ayurvedic diagnostics and pharmacology, but also anatomy, pathology, physiology, and the clinical management of disease. It is the foundation that separates a physician from a therapist.

Treatments Prescribed at Brahmi

Dr. Athira prescribes from a full range of classical Kerala Ayurvedic therapies, selecting and combining them based on each patient’s assessed needs. Depending on the condition and constitution, a plan may involve one or several of the following:

Abhyangam Treatment

Abhyangam

Full-body medicated oil massage for circulation, nervous system support, and rejuvenation.

Shirodhara Ayurvedic oil therapy at Brahmi Ayurvedic Healing center in Dubai

Shiro Dhara

Continuous oil stream to the forehead for stress, insomnia, and migraines.

Pizhichil Ayurvedic therapy at Brahmi Ayurvedic Healing center in Dubai

Pizhichil

Continuous oil bath for neurological conditions and deep Vata imbalance.

Patra Pinda Sweda (Ela Kizhi) Ayurvedic herbal poultice massage therapy at Brahmi Ayurvedic Healing center in Dubai

Kizhi (Ela Kizhi / Patra Pinda Sweda)

Heated herbal pouch therapy for joints, muscles, and inflammation.

Nasyam Ayurvedic nasal therapy at Brahmi Ayurvedic Healing center in Dubai

Nasyam

Nasal administration for sinus conditions, chronic headaches, and neurological concerns.

Kati Vasti treatment

Kati Vasti / Greeva Vasti / Janu Vasti / Uro Vasti

Targeted medicated oil pooling for back, neck, knees, and chest.

Thakradhara Ayurvedic therapeutic buttermilk flow therapy at Brahmi Ayurvedic Healing center in Dubai

Thakradhara

Medicated buttermilk therapy for scalp conditions and stress-related heat disorders.

PANCHAKARMA Treatment

Panchakarma

Structured multi-day detoxification and deep cleansing program.

Udwardhana treatment

Udwarthana

Herbal powder massage for weight management and lymphatic stimulation.

Swedana Ayurvedic therapeutic steam treatment at Brahmi Ayurvedic Healing center in Dubai

Swedana

Herbal steam therapy used in preparation for deeper cleansing treatments.

Dhanyamla-Dhara

Dhanyamla Dhara

Warm fermented herbal liquid pour for inflammation and metabolic conditions.

Lepanam

Lepanam

Fresh herbal paste for localised inflammation and skin conditions.

Marmatherapy

Marma Therapy

Vital point stimulation for hormonal and systemic balance.

Padabhyanga Treatment

Padabhyanga

Ayurvedic foot massage for sleep support and systemic grounding.

SHIRO ABHYANGA

Shiro Abhyanga

Focused head, neck, and shoulder oil massage.

Mukhalepam Ayurvedic herbal facial treatment at Brahmi Ayurvedic Healing center in Dubai

Mukhalepam

Ayurvedic herbal facial for skin rejuvenation, pigmentation, and clarity.

Why DHA Licensing Matters When You Choose a Clinic

Dubai’s healthcare authority, the DHA, sets the regulatory standard for medical practice in the emirate. A DHA-licensed Ayurvedic clinic is required to employ qualified medical personnel, maintain clinical documentation, follow safety protocols, and operate under the oversight appropriate to a medical facility.

Not every centre offering Ayurvedic therapies in Dubai holds this licence. Some operate as wellness or lifestyle businesses, outside the healthcare regulatory framework entirely.
